Bio:
Dr. Thomas M. Durcan is an Associate Professor within the Montreal Neurological Institute (The Neuro) and McGill University. He is also Director of the Neuro’s Early Drug Discovery Unit (EDDU), focused on the use of human induced pluripotent stem cells (iPSCs) for fundamental and translational discovery project through partnerships with academia and industry. Founded over a decade ago, the group has established a cohort of 250+ iPSCs that have been advanced into different projects within the group and used to generate a wide range of neuronal and glial subtypes, in addition to more advanced 3D brain organoid models. With the lines, methods and workflows in place, they work with researchers and companies as "The First Step" in helping take a target and move it towards a therapy for diseases of the brain, from Parkinson's disease, to ALS, neurodevelopmental disorders to more recent work on rare inherited CNS disorders.
